Anacardium occidentale is a homeopathic medicine made in France that helps with itching and skin rash. It contains 0.443 mg of the active ingredient per pellet and comes in a pack that has around 80 pellets. The medicine is intended for adult use and children can take it too. The directions are to dissolve 5 pellets under the tongue 3 times a day until symptoms are relieved or as directed by a doctor. One should stop using the medicine and ask a doctor if symptoms persist for more than 3 days or worsen. If pregnant or breastfeeding, it is recommended that one ask a health professional before using the medicine. Inactive ingredients include lactose and sucrose.*
